Is it Knighttime Yet in Downtown Orlando? Today, March 2nd, 2016, the Florida Board of Governors approved UCF’s plan to build a major campus in the heart of Downtown Orlando within the upcoming Creative Village project. This announcement comes one day after the Dr. Phillips Charities announced a very generous $3 million dollar gift supporting its development; this has brought private commitments up to over $16 million to date. The goal for private commitments is $20 million and for the State of Florida to match with another $20 million to help fund phase 1 of the new campus. Will this round be successful? Or will it be shutdown by a veto pen as happened last year? My guess (and hope), is second time is a charm!
What will a UCF campus mean for DTO (that’s code for DownTown Orlando)? It could be the most significant game changer in years. DTO needs a 24/7 catalyst and a university presence can help; especially for the Paramore District. I predict that UCF Downtown will cause the Church Street Corridor, anchored by the Amway Center, to fuse up with Creative Village and create a walk-able, livable downtown area. Further, the relatively quiet zone of Orange ave north of Washington St. should see a boost as well; especially given the now filled-in North Quarter. That means our CBD (Central Business District for you homegamers) could triple in size over the next ten years. That is amazing!
